افزایش سرعت اجرای کوئری با Parallel Query در Oracle
افزایش سرعت اجرای کوئری با Parallel Query در Oracle | راهنمای بهینه سازی کوئری

مقدمه : استفاده از Parallel Query در اوراکل چه اهمیتی دارد؟ در دنیای دیتابیس‌های سازمانی، زمان اجرای کوئری‌ها نقش بسیار مهمی در عملکرد کلی سیستم دارد. Oracle به عنوان یکی از قدرتمندترین پایگاه‌های داده، امکان اجرای کوئری‌ها به صورت پردازش موازی (Parallel Execution) را فراهم کرده است.در این مقاله، یاد…

معرفی کامل پکیج DBMS_RANDOM در Oracle Database + کاربردها و مثال‌ها
معرفی کامل پکیج DBMS_RANDOM در Oracle Database + کاربردها و مثال‌ها

مقدمه : پکیج DBMS_RANDOM در اوراکل چه اهمیتی دارد؟ در بسیاری از پروژه‌های پایگاه داده، نیاز داریم تا داده‌های تصادفی یا تستی تولید کنیم.به‌عنوان مثال، هنگام تست یک سیستم مدیریت منابع انسانی یا فروشگاه اینترنتی، باید هزاران رکورد ساختگی داشته باشیم تا عملکرد کوئری‌ها و گزارش‌ها را بررسی کنیم.در Oracle…

چگونه با Partitioning در Oracle سرعت کوئری‌ها را افزایش دهیم؟
چگونه با Partitioning در Oracle سرعت کوئری‌ها را افزایش دهیم؟ | آموزش بهینه‌سازی SQL

مقدمه : چگونه Partitioning در Oracle می تواند سرعت کوئری‌ها را افزایش دهد؟ یکی از چالش‌های اصلی در مدیریت پایگاه داده‌های حجیم، کاهش زمان اجرای کوئری‌ها است. Oracle Database ابزار قدرتمندی به نام Partitioning در اختیار ما قرار می‌دهد که می‌تواند کوئری‌ها را به‌طرز چشمگیری سریع‌تر کند.در این مقاله، یاد…

تفاوت Local Index و Global Index در Oracle | راهنمای بهینه‌سازی ایندکس در جداول پارتیشن‌بندی‌شده
تفاوت Local Index و Global Index در Oracle | راهنمای بهینه‌سازی ایندکس در جداول پارتیشن‌بندی‌شده

مقدمه : چرا شناخت ایندکس‌ها در Oracle اهمیت دارد؟ اگر با پایگاه داده Oracle کار می‌کنید، مخصوصاً در پروژه‌هایی با حجم زیاد داده، حتماً با اصطلاحاتی مانند Local Index و Global Index مواجه شده‌اید.این مفاهیم، در ساختار Partitioned Tables یا جداول پارتیشن‌شده، اهمیت حیاتی دارند و نقش مستقیمی در افزایش…

لیست کامل Hints در اوراکل
لیست کامل Hints در اوراکل | راهنمای بهینه سازی کوئری

مقدمه : در اوراکل hints چرا اهمیت دارد؟ در پایگاه داده اوراکل (Oracle Database)، Hints بهینه‌ساز کوئری (Optimizer) را راهنمایی می‌کنند تا بهترین روش اجرا را برای یک دستور SQL انتخاب کند.این ویژگی به توسعه‌دهندگان اجازه می‌دهد کنترل بهتری بر نحوه پردازش کوئری‌ها داشته باشند و عملکرد پایگاه داده را…

چگونه از Index Monitoring در اوراکل استفاده کنیم؟ | راهنمای جامع
چگونه از Index Monitoring در اوراکل استفاده کنیم؟ | راهنمای بهینه سازی کوئری

مقدمه : Index Monitoring در اوراکل چه اهمیتی دارد؟ ایندکس‌ها در Oracle Database نقش کلیدی در بهینه‌سازی عملکرد کوئری‌ها دارند.اما برخی ایندکس‌ها ممکن است غیرضروری باشند و فقط فضای ذخیره‌سازی را اشغال کرده و عملکرد DML (INSERT, UPDATE, DELETE) را کند کنند.Index Monitoring یکی از ابزارهای مفید اوراکل است که…

B-Tree vs. Bitmap Index – کدام بهتر است؟
B-Tree vs. Bitmap Index – کدام بهتر است؟

مقدمه : در اوراکل ایندکس Bitmap و B-Tree چه تفاوتی باهم دارند؟ در پایگاه‌های داده رابطه‌ای (RDBMS) مانند Oracle Database، ایندکس‌ها برای افزایش سرعت جستجوها و بهبود عملکرد کوئری‌ها استفاده می‌شوند. دو نوع پرکاربرد ایندکس‌ها عبارت‌اند از:B-Tree Index (ایندکس درختی متوازن)Bitmap Index (ایندکس مبتنی بر بیت‌مپ)هر یک از این ایندکس‌ها…

نحوه انتخاب بهترین ایندکس برای بهینه‌سازی کوئری‌ها در Oracle SQL
نحوه انتخاب بهترین ایندکس برای بهینه‌سازی کوئری‌ها در Oracle SQL

مقدمه : استفاده از ایندکس در Oracle Database چه اهمیتی دارد؟ یکی از بزرگ‌ترین چالش‌های مدیریت پایگاه داده‌های رابطه‌ای، بهینه‌سازی عملکرد کوئری‌ها است. ایندکس‌ها (Indexes) در Oracle SQL نقش بسیار مهمی در افزایش سرعت جستجو و کاهش زمان اجرای کوئری‌ها دارند.اما انتخاب نادرست ایندکس نه‌تنها عملکرد را بهبود نمی‌بخشد، بلکه…

پارتیشن بندی در اوراکل
راهنمای جامع پارتیشن‌بندی در اوراکل (Oracle Partitioning) – افزایش کارایی پایگاه داده

مقدمه : استفاده از پارتیشن‌بندی در اوراکل چه اهمیتی دارد؟ در پایگاه‌های داده‌ای که حجم اطلاعات بالاست، بهینه‌سازی عملکرد و مدیریت داده‌ها اهمیت زیادی دارد. یکی از تکنیک‌های کلیدی برای افزایش کارایی پایگاه داده اوراکل، پارتیشن‌بندی (Oracle Partitioning) است. پارتیشن‌بندی در اوراکل، جدول‌های بزرگ را به بخش‌های کوچک‌تر تقسیم می‌کند…

راهنمای جامع Chain در Oracle Database – مدیریت وابستگی Jobها در اوراکل
راهنمای جامع Chain در Oracle Database – مدیریت وابستگی Jobها در اوراکل

مقدمه : استفاده از Chain در اوراکل چه اهمیتی دارد؟ در Oracle Database، یکی از قابلیت‌های پیشرفته برای مدیریت فرآیندهای وابسته، استفاده از Chain در Oracle Scheduler است.Chain به ما اجازه می‌دهد که Jobها را به‌صورت وابسته به هم اجرا کنیم،به این معنا که اجرای یک مرحله می‌تواند وابسته به…